Flutter Engine
The Flutter Engine
Namespaces | Functions
SkSLFieldAccess.cpp File Reference
#include "src/sksl/ir/SkSLFieldAccess.h"
#include "include/core/SkSpan.h"
#include "include/core/SkTypes.h"
#include "include/private/base/SkTArray.h"
#include "src/sksl/SkSLAnalysis.h"
#include "src/sksl/SkSLBuiltinTypes.h"
#include "src/sksl/SkSLConstantFolder.h"
#include "src/sksl/SkSLContext.h"
#include "src/sksl/SkSLDefines.h"
#include "src/sksl/SkSLErrorReporter.h"
#include "src/sksl/SkSLOperator.h"
#include "src/sksl/ir/SkSLConstructorStruct.h"
#include "src/sksl/ir/SkSLFunctionDeclaration.h"
#include "src/sksl/ir/SkSLMethodReference.h"
#include "src/sksl/ir/SkSLSetting.h"
#include "src/sksl/ir/SkSLSymbol.h"
#include "src/sksl/ir/SkSLSymbolTable.h"
#include <cstddef>

Go to the source code of this file.

Namespaces

namespace  SkSL
 

Functions

static std::unique_ptr< Expression > SkSL::extract_field (Position pos, const ConstructorStruct &ctor, int fieldIndex)